Zac Efron Reads The Lorax To New York Schoolchildren
Zac and Danny had agreed to take part in the reading event to help promote the American Literacy Campaign. Zac said "As a kid, I remember thinking, 'What would it be like to go on this big adventure and learn what the Once-ler knows?' Now here I am, two decades later, voicing Ted in Dr Seuss' The Lorax. It's an honour to not only be a part of this movie, but to work with the National Education Association's Read Across America to inspire the love of reading in millions of kids." The reading took place on March 2, 2012, which also marked Dr Seuss' 108th birthday.
Dr Seuss' The Lorax opened in cinemas last weekend and had the highest-grossing opening weekend at the box office of any movie released this year, raking in sales of over $70 million. It also became the highest grossing debut of any Dr. Seuss adaptation, including Horton Hears a Who.
